Introduction With the Nokia Bluetooth Headset BH-701 you can make and receive calls while on the move and use your mobile device hands free. If charging does not start, disconnect the charger, plug it in again, and retry. The fully charged battery has power for up to 6 hours of talk time or up to 160 hours of standby time. However, the talk and standby times may vary when used with different compatible Bluetooth devices, usage settings, usage styles, and environments. When battery power is low, the headset beeps at regular intervals, and the indicator light flashes red. 8 Get started Switch the headset on or off To switch on, press and hold the multifunction key until the headset beeps and the indicator light turns on. When the headset tries to connect to a paired device, the indicator light flashes green slowly. When the headset is connected to a paired device and is ready for use, the indicator light flashes blue slowly. If the headset has not been paired with a device, it automatically enters the pairing mode (see "Pair the headset, " p. To switch off, press and hold the multifunction key for at least 5 seconds until the indicator light turns red. Pair the headset 1. To pair the headset if it has not been previously paired with a device, switch on the headset. The headset enters the pairing mode, and the indicator light starts to flash blue quickly. To pair the headset if it has been previously paired with another device, ensure that the headset is switched off, and press and hold the multifunction key until the indicator lights starts to flash blue quickly. Activate the Bluetooth feature on the mobile device, and set it to search for Bluetooth devices. Enter the passcode 0000 to pair and connect the headset to your device. In some mobile devices, you may need to make the connection 9 Get started separately after pairing. If the pairing is successful, the headset appears in the menu of the mobile device where you can view the currently paired Bluetooth devices. Disconnect the headset To disconnect the headset from your mobile device, switch off the headset, or disconnect the headset in the Bluetooth menu of your device. You do not need to delete the pairing with the headset to disconnect it. Reconnect the headset To connect the headset to your mobile device, make the connection in the Bluetooth menu of your device; or switch on the headset, and press and hold the multifunction key for about 2 to 3 seconds until you hear a short beep. You can set your device to connect with the headset automatically when the headset is switched on. To do this in Nokia devices, change your paired device settings in the Bluetooth menu. Troubleshooting If you cannot connect the headset to your mobile device, do as follows: · Ensure that the headset is charged, switched on, and paired with your device. · Ensure that the Bluetooth feature is activated on your device. 10 Get started · Ensure that the headset is within 10 meters (30 feet) of your device and that there are no obstructions between the headset and the device, such as walls, or other electronic devices. 11 Basic use 3. [. . . ] The battery can be charged and discharged hundreds of times, but it will eventually wear out. Recharge your battery only with Nokia approved chargers designated for this device. Unplug the charger from the electrical plug and the device when not in use. Do not leave a fully charged battery connected to a charger, since overcharging may shorten its lifetime. [. . . ]
